Financial Assistance Agreement • One contract for PHD funding – Financial Assistance Agreement • Program Elements for each work component inserted into the contract • Not all entities are funded through all program elements PUBLIC HEALTH DIVISION Office of the State Public Health Director 15
What is a Program Element? • Part of the Financial Assistance Agreement • Describes work to be done • Data collection and/or reporting requirements PUBLIC HEALTH DIVISION Office of the State Public Health Director 16
Program Element Development • Drafting of Program Element • CLHO Subcommittee and/or OHA Tribal Meeting – input and recommendations • CLHO approval and/or SB 770 Health Cluster support • Office of Contracts review (may include Department of Justice review) • Inclusion in contract amendment (monthly amendment summary) PUBLIC HEALTH DIVISION Office of the State Public Health Director 17
Funding Formula Development • Usually part of Program Element process • Change may be negotiated if PHD funding increases or decreases • More likely to occur with new grant cycles • CLHO Subcommittee and/or OHA Tribal Meeting – input and recommendations • CLHO and/or SB 770 Health Cluster support PUBLIC HEALTH DIVISION Office of the State Public Health Director 18
Types of Funding Mechanisms • Base funding • Base plus per-capita or other criteria • Competitive Request for Proposals – More stringent process – Technical assistance driven by contracting rules – usually more limited or standardized – Competitive funding (usually based on budget submission and negotiation if award made) PUBLIC HEALTH DIVISION Office of the State Public Health Director 19
Program Element and Funding Formula Considerations • • Funder requirements and eligibility parameters Evidence-based and promising practices Data and epidemiology What can be achieved with funding available Work needed in the state, local and tribal jurisdictions Overall funding amount Ability to maintain and/or secure future funding for core public health work PUBLIC HEALTH DIVISION Office of the State Public Health Director 20
